Recognizing the service of all District of Columbia veterans, condemning the denial of voting representation in Congress and full local self-government for veterans and their families who are District of Columbia residents, and calling for statehood for the District of Columbia through the enactment of the Washington, D.C. Admission Act (H.R. 51 and S. 51), particularly in light of the service of District of Columbia veterans in every American war.

This resolution recognizes the profound service and sacrifice of all District of Columbia veterans, highlighting their contributions in every American war. It specifically notes the unique circumstance of these approximately 30,000 veterans who have served without full voting representation in Congress or complete local self-government. The resolution condemns this denial of fundamental democratic rights for DC residents, including veterans and their families, despite their historical military service and casualties that have exceeded those of many states. The resolution advocates for the immediate enactment of the Washington, D.C. Admission Act (H.R. 51 and S. 51) to achieve statehood for the District of Columbia. This act would grant full and equal voting rights in Congress and unimpeded democratic control over local affairs, making the District the 51st State. The call for statehood is particularly underscored by the unwavering service of DC veterans, and the resolution notes that the House of Representatives has previously passed this statehood bill twice.
